Guest User

Untitled

a guest
Jan 12th, 2018
85
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 1.17 KB | None | 0 0
  1. As pessoas que desejam trabalhar nesse projeto terá que ter prévio conhecimento em Javascript, Jquery, API's e muita perseverança.
  2.  
  3.  
  4. CONFIGURANDO O AMBIENTE NO LINUX, MAC E WINDOWS:
  5.  
  6. Instalar dependências de projeto:
  7.  
  8. npm install
  9. Dependências instaladas, vamos entender a estrutura inicial. Você vai encontrar alguns arquivos já criados e trabalhar a partir daí.
  10. A primeira coisa que você precisa fazer é rodar na sua linha de comando o seguinte:
  11.  
  12. Projeto Angular
  13.  
  14. npm start
  15. Projeto JQuery
  16.  
  17. npm run-script start-local
  18. E com o seu servidor aberto rode:
  19.  
  20. npm test
  21.  
  22. CONVENÇÃO PARA NOME DE ARQUIVOS E COMPONENTES:
  23.  
  24. username
  25. email
  26. password
  27. state
  28. city
  29. accepts_newsletters
  30.  
  31. Os nomes dos inputs devem manter o padrão dos nomes anteriores.
  32.  
  33. POLÍTICA PARA TRATAMENTO DE ERROS NA COMUNICAÇÃO COM A API:
  34.  
  35. As mensagens de erro devem ser exibidas em uma -tag small- com as classes form-text
  36. e text-danger após o input com erro (<small class="form-text text-danger">Campo inválido</small>)
  37.  
  38. REGRAS PARA VALIDAÇÕES DOS CAMPOS:
  39.  
  40. o button só é ativado caso o formulário não tenha erros (deve ficar no estado disabled por padrão)
  41. O input é validado no estado focusout
Add Comment
Please, Sign In to add comment